530-830 are the next generation and have fixed a lot of Garmin woes,
DCRainmaker is keen on both.

Main issue with the older Garmin’s was the processor was so slow, 520 plus
has a reputation for being dreadful for this.

A friend has a 530 which seems ok, I have a much older and slower Touring
which is quite feature rich for navigation but quite slow.
